The Land Rover Range Rover, often simply referred to as the Range Rover, is a flagship luxury SUV renowned for its blend of refined comfort and off-road capability. Manufactured by the British automaker Land Rover, a subsidiary of Jaguar Land Rover, it has established a reputation since its debut in 1970 for combining sophisticated design with rugged performance. The latest models feature advanced terrain response systems, luxurious interiors, and powerful engine options, making it a versatile choice for both city driving and challenging terrains. With a history rooted in innovation and durability, the Range Rover continues to set standards in the luxury SUV segment, appealing to those seeking a vehicle that offers both prestige and practicality.

Understanding MOT Defect Categories

Dangerous Direct and immediate risk to road safety or the environment. Vehicle must not be driven until repaired.
Major May affect safety, environment, or other road users. Repair immediately.
Minor No significant effect on safety but should be repaired as soon as possible.
Advisory Could become more serious in the future. Monitor and repair if necessary.
